Understanding Token Limits in Client-Server Communication

In the realm of client-server communication, particularly when using services like the MCP platform, developers often encounter challenges related to token limits. These token limits define the constraints on the size and number of tokens that can be transmitted in a single request. This can become a significant hurdle when attempting to process large JSON responses, as exceeding these limits can lead to truncated data or errors.

Impact of Large JSON Responses on Token Limit

Large JSON responses can dramatically influence the efficiency and reliability of data exchange between clients and servers. When the amount of data exceeds the token threshold, it may result in performance degradation or incomplete information being delivered. This highlights the importance of effectively managing token limits, especially when working with extensive datasets.

Strategies for Handling Token Limit Issues

To effectively handle token limits when dealing with sizable JSON responses, several strategies may be employed. These strategies can help ensure that the data transfer process remains smooth and reliable. One common approach is to paginate large data sets, breaking them into smaller, manageable chunks that fit within the token limit. Another method involves compressing the JSON payload before sending it over the network, thus reducing its size.

Effective Strategies Include:

  • Data pagination for large datasets
  • JSON compression for smaller payloads
  • Incremental querying to retrieve data pieces
  • Using streams to handle data in real-time

Utilizing Code Snippets to Ease the Process

Implementing the above strategies can be facilitated with appropriate coding practices. For example, when paginating a large JSON response, utilizing a loop to repeatedly request smaller batches can be beneficial. Below is an illustrative code snippet demonstrating how you might implement pagination in your client-server interaction:

Pagination Example in JavaScript

const fetchPaginatedData = async (pageNumber) => {
    const response = await fetch(`YOUR_API_ENDPOINT?page=${pageNumber}`);
    const data = await response.json();
    return data;
};

const processAllData = async () => {
    let page = 1;
    let moreData = true;

    while (moreData) {
        const data = await fetchPaginatedData(page);
        if (data.length > 0) {
            // Process data
            console.log(data);
            page++;
        } else {
            moreData = false;
        }
    }
};
processAllData();
